All of the products in this roundup explicitly say they have no back door, and that is as it ought to be. It will mean that if you encrypt an essential document and then forget the encryption password, then you have lost it for good.

Back in the day, in the event that you wanted to keep a document key you can use a cipher to encrypt it and then burn the original. Or you might lock it up in a protected. The two main approaches in encryption utilities parallel with these options.

One sort of product simply procedures files and folders, turning them into impenetrable encrypted versions of these. The other creates a virtual disc that, when open, acts like any other drive on your system. When you lock the digital drive, each of the documents you put into it are completely inaccessible. .

Like the digital drive solution, a few goods save your encrypted information in the cloud. This approach requires extreme care, obviously. Encrypted information in the cloud has a much larger attack surface than encrypted data on your own PC.

Which is better It really depends on how you plan to use encryption. If you're not sure, take advantage of this 30-day free trial provided by each of those products to have a sense of the different options.

After you copy a file into protected storage, or create an encrypted version of it, then you absolutely need to wipe the unencrypted original. Just deleting it isn't sufficient, even if you bypass the Recycle Bin, because the data still exists on disc, and data retrieval utilities can often return back. .

Some encryption products avoid this issue by encrypting the document in place, literally overwriting it on disc using an encrypted version. It's more common, though, to offer safe deletion as an option. If you choose something that lacks this feature, you should find a free secure deletion tool to use along with it. .

Overwriting data before deletion is sufficient to balk software-based retrieval tools. Hardware-based forensic retrieval functions because the magnetic recording of information on a hard drive isn't actually digital. It's more of a waveform. In simple terms, the procedure involves nulling out the known data and reading around the edges of what is left.

An encryption algorithm is like a black box. Dump a document, picture, or other file into it, and you get back what seems like gibberish. Run that gibberish back through the box, using the same password, and you get back the original.

The U.S. government has depended on Advanced Encryption Standard (AES) as a standard, and all of the merchandise accumulated here support AES. Even the ones that support other algorithms tend to recommend using AES.

If you're an encryption specialist, you might prefer another algorithm, Blowfish, possibly, or even the Soviet government's GOST. For the average user, however, AES is just fine.

Passwords are important, and you have to keep them secret, right Well, not when you use Public Key Infrastructure (PKI) cryptography.

With PKI, you get two keys. One is public; you can share it with anyone, register it in a key exchange, tattoo it on your foreheadwhatever you like. The other is private, and should be carefully guarded. If I want to send you a secret document, I just encrypt it with your public key.

Simple! .

Using this system in reverse, you can create an electronic signature which proves your document came from you and hasn't been modified. How Just click this link encrypt it with your private key. The fact your public key decrypts it is all of the evidence you need. PKI support is less common than support for traditional symmetric algorithms. .

If you want to talk about a file with someone and your encryption application doesn't support PKI, there are different options for sharing. Many products allow creation of a self-decrypting executable file. You could also find that the recipient can use a free, decryption-only tool.
